Mission LX-5 MKII is a 2-way Passive Bass Reflex Floor-standing speaker by Mission. It was released in 2021. It features a 1" Soft-Dome Tweeter and 2 x 6.5" Composite fibre Woofer.
A 2-way bass-reflex floorstander with 2 x 6.5 inch composite fibre bass drivers and a 1 inch soft-dome treble unit. 90 dB sensitive, 8 ohms nominal (4.2 ohms minimum), 42 Hz to 20 kHz. LX MKII is the entry range: composite-fibre cones and a 25 mm microfibre dome, in a cabinet Mission tuned to be forgiving about placement.
The speaker has a frequency range of 42-20k Hz and a sensitivity of 90 dB.

Frequency Response of the Mission LX-5 MKII Speaker
Mission LX-5 MKII has a Frequency response range of 42-20k Hz at ±3dB and Power Range of 30-150 watts. With a minimum frequency of 42 Hz, LX-5 MKII delivers deep bass that will likely satisfy most listeners, especially those who enjoy music. However, movie enthusiasts and music fans who prefer a full range of sound may still benefit from adding a subwoofer.

Crossover frequency of the Mission LX-5 MKII?
The Crossover frequency of the LX-5 MKII is set to 2.3kHz. This is the threshold frequency where the higher frequency signals over this level are sent to the tweeter and the lower-frequency signals are sent to the woofer by the crossover component.

Minimum Impedance of the Mission LX-5 MKII
Even though the nominal impedance of the LX-5 MKII is 8 ohms, the minimum impedance level of this speaker according to Mission is 4.2 ohms Mission LX-5 MKII so while choosing an amplifier, you should ideally check if the unit you are considering can provide this impedance level.

Input Type
LX-5 MKII features Binding post type connectors. Bi-amping and Bi-wiring are not possible.
Mission LX-5 MKII External Dimensions and Weight
Mission LX-5 MKII has external dimensions of (Height x Width x Depth) 39-3/16 x 8-7/8 x 12-1/8inch (995.0 x 226.0 x 308.0mm ).

Cabinet type and Materials
Mission LX-5 MKII has a
Bass Reflex type cabinet. Bass Reflex type loudspeakers (aka Ported, Vented or Reflex Port) have enclosures that uses a port, hole or vent cut into the cabinet. Ported designs are generally more efficient than the Sealed designs.
Does the Mission LX-5 MKII come with a Grille?
LX-5 MKII comes with grilles. The purpose of the grille is to protect the delicate driver elements from external impacts while still allowing the sound to pass as clearly as possible.
